Mechanical Assessment

AI-generated interpretation of this vehicle’s MOT record — not an official statement and not a substitute for an independent inspection.

The vehicle is currently roadworthy, but the maintenance trend indicates a reactive approach to repairs rather than preventative care. While the most recent test in March 2026 at 180,308 miles passed, it revealed a severely deteriorated nearside front outer driveshaft CV boot. This follows a pattern of failure in previous years where faults were only addressed after failing an inspection. The presence of minor corrosion under the vehicle surface suggests that structural integrity is beginning to show its age, which will require closer monitoring. At 180,308 miles over 15 years, this Polo has covered an average of approximately 12,000 miles per year. The data shows consistent high-mileage, with roughly 12,000 miles recorded between the 2024 and 2025 tests and another 11,763 miles between March 2025 and March 2026. This constant usage places significant stress on wear-related components. The recurring mention of oil leaks since 2024 suggests that the engine seals or gaskets are failing due to the high mileage and the vehicle's life life. A buyer must personally inspect the front suspension and braking system, as these areas show persistent issues. The MacPherson strut top bushes, ball joints, and track rod ends have been flagged as worn or damaged repeatedly. The front brake discs were noted as pitted and scored in both 2024 and 2025, indicating they are nearing the end of their functional life. Furthermore, the history of corrosion on the rear coil springs and axle necessitates a thorough under-body check to ensure the rust has not progressed to a structural failure that would lead to a future MOT rejection.

MOT Analysis

Interpretation generated from the recorded test data above — not an official DVSA statement and not a substitute for an independent inspection.

5 MOT tests are recorded for this 2011 Volkswagen Polo (FV11 FBC) between March 2024 and March 2026.

The record contains 3 passes and 2 failures.

The most recent test on 28 March 2026 was a pass, although the earlier record includes 2 failures that buyers may want to investigate.

Across all tests, the most frequently flagged areas are: Brakes (5 issues), Lighting (4 issues), Tyres (4 issues), Suspension (3 issues), Windscreen (3 issues). Repeated mentions in one area can indicate an ongoing pattern worth checking in person.

In total 19 advisory notices are recorded. Advisories flag items that passed but may need attention before the next test; they are not evidence of how well the vehicle has been serviced.

Recorded failure items include: “Nearside Front Suspension arm ball joint dust cover no longer prevents the ingress of dirt (5.3.4 (b) (ii))”; “Offside Front Track rod end ball joint dust cover excessively damaged or deteriorated so that it no longer prevents the ”; “Emissions unable to be completed exhaust box silencer missing (8.2.2.2 (e))”.
